3. Widebody Conversion Kits
Widebody kits transform the Huracan EVO into a far more aggressive machine.
Typical components include:
● Wider front fenders
● Rear quarter extensions
● Wheel arch guards
● Wider side skirts
● Extended bumpers
Widebody conversions allow for larger wheels and tires, improving grip while creating an unmistakable supercar stance.

Materials Explained
● FRP (Fiberglass Reinforced Plastic): It’s a composite where the reinforcement fiber is glass (often called GFRP) set inside a polymer matrix. It is highly durable, flexible, and impact-resistant. It is also the heaviest and least rigid of the three. It’s best used for boat hulls, automotive body kits, water slides, and structural panels requiring high impact resistance without premium pricing.
● CFRP (Carbon Fiber Reinforced Polymer): A composite utilizing carbon fibers instead of glass fibers to reinforce a plastic/resin base. It is exceptionally lightweight (about 70% lighter than fiberglass) and highly rigid, offering a superior strength-to-weight ratio compared to metal. It is more brittle than FRP. It’s best used for aerospace components, high-end sporting goods, and premium automotive racing parts.
● Dry Carbon Fiber: A specific, premium manufacturing variation of CFRP. Standard carbon fiber is "wet," meaning liquid resin is brushed or poured onto the woven fibers. Dry carbon is made using pre-impregnated ("pre-preg") sheets that already contain the optimal amount of resin from the factory. Because it is baked in an autoclave (a specialized high-pressure oven) rather than air-cured, dry carbon is roughly 20-30% stronger and lighter than standard wet carbon. It also yields a flawless, void-free finish. It’s best used for high-performance motorsport and exotic car components where maximum weight reduction is paramount.

Investment and Pricing
The cost of Huracan EVO upgrades varies by scope and materials.
Typical Price Ranges
● Front splitter: $1,000–$3,000
● Rear diffuser: $2,000–$5,000
● Fixed wing: $3,000–$8,000
● Full body kit: $13,000–$25,000+
● Widebody conversion: $20,000+
Premium dry carbon fiber options command higher prices but offer unmatched performance and finish quality.
Maintenance Tips for Carbon Fiber Parts
To preserve your investment:
● Wash with pH-neutral soap
● Use ceramic coating or UV protection
● Avoid abrasive cleaners
● Inspect mounting hardware regularly
Proper care keeps carbon fiber glossy and protected for years.
